Mayo Older People’s Council Information Day

This event was held in Park Hotel, Kiltimagh, Co. Mayo on the 31st May 2023, to promote and  highlight the work of the OPC, while also extending invitation to public to become a member. 

Information on the day included presentation from Professor Tom O’Malley (Geriatrician/ Stroke Physician), Saolta University Healthcare Group / Age Friendly Programme – Mairéad Cranley and Maura Murphy / Sergeant Paul Maher – Digital Register of Older People in North Mayo for AGS / Living with long-term medical health conditions – Ailish Houlihan, HSE.  Guests were also “treated” to some on-the-spot dancing and exercise!

Sr. Maureen Lally, Age Friendly Ambassador, finished event with an energising talk on the importance of people, volunteers, and community. 

The event was attended by over one hundred people. 

There were also information stands with members of the Alliance advising people of supports and services in Mayo. Free blood pressure checks were available and finally a raffle to close off the event.
